Transaction 1181ec2e77031cc651b90968d73626a2f7224fa8d4dcac5be0e915911771c831
1 Input
1 Output
-
1181ec2e77031cc651b90968d73626a2f7224fa8d4dcac5be0e915911771c831:0
- value
- 5619066
- script pubkey
- OP_0 OP_PUSHBYTES_20 043b71c95d8f304d6b2ec99ef1ee2290bf23b558
- address
- bc1qqsahrj2a3ucy66ewex00rm3zjzlj8d2cjtk3d7